What is a Spectrum network engineer?
Career: Spectrum Network Engineer
A Spectrum Network Engineer is a professional responsible for designing, implementing, maintaining, and optimizing network systems for companies like Spectrum, which is a major telecommunications provider. They work with a variety of network technologies, including fiber optics, wireless, and cable systems, to ensure reliable and high-speed internet and communication services for customers. Their duties may also include troubleshooting network issues, upgrading infrastructure, and ensuring network security. Spectrum Network Engineers often collaborate with other IT professionals to support large-scale network projects and resolve technical challenges.
